abstract = {Let        S          H      ,      K        =  {      S    t          H      ,      K        ,  t  ≥  0  } be the sub-bifractional Brownian motion (sbfBm) of dimension 1, with indices    H  ∈  (  0  ,  1  ) and    K  ∈  (  0  ,  1  ]  . We mainly consider the existence of the self-intersection local time and its derivative for the sbfBm. Moreover, we prove its derivative is H             o      ¨      lder continuous in space variable and time variable, respectively.}
